Output 3fca5c7cef82fbb9eff6a2b97b6057df0b867ffc2830ab1b14be90b36c5e84e0:5

value
128937
script pubkey
OP_0 OP_PUSHBYTES_20 ac3ee09b227be03cc933a0cafb12186bef28942e
address
bc1q4slwpxez00srejfn5r90kyscd0hj39pw2kfsnc
transaction
3fca5c7cef82fbb9eff6a2b97b6057df0b867ffc2830ab1b14be90b36c5e84e0
confirmations
21898
spent
true